Here’s where it gets real: The technical differences in detail

Hilux

Costs and Efficiency:

Price and efficiency are key factors when choosing a car – and this is often where the real differences emerge.

Toyota Hilux is clearly cheaper – starting at 45,800 £ , while the McLaren GT Series costs 175,700 £ . That’s a price difference of around 129,865 £.

Fuel consumption also shows a difference: the Toyota Hilux uses 9.8 L/100km and is visibly more efficient than the McLaren GT Series with 11.9 L/100km. The difference is about 2.1 L/100km.

GT Series

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ration are the classic benchmarks for car enthusiasts – and here, some clear differences start to show.

When it comes to engine power, the McLaren GT Series offers significantly more power – delivering 635 HP compared to 204 HP. That’s roughly 431 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the McLaren GT Series is considerably quicker – completing the sprint in 3.2 s, while the Toyota Hilux takes 9.9 s. That’s about 6.7 s quicker.

There’s also a difference in torque: the McLaren GT Series delivers clearly more torque with 630 Nm compared to 500 Nm. That’s about 130 Nm more.

Hilux

Space and Everyday Use:

Cabin size, boot volume and payload all play a role in everyday practicality. Here, comfort and flexibility make the difference.

Seats: Toyota Hilux offers more seats – 5 vs 2.

In terms of curb weight, McLaren GT Series is clearly lighter – 1,520 kg compared to 2,250 kg. The difference is around 730 kg.

Toyota Hilux

The Toyota Hilux is a no-nonsense pick-up that blends worksite toughness with proper off-road ability, built to shrug off punishment and keep going long after fancier rivals give up. It won’t win any beauty contests, but buyers who want a practical, rugged truck that simply gets the job done will appreciate its honest, hard-working character.

details

McLaren GT Series

The McLaren GT takes the supercar blueprint and stretches it into a grand tourer, marrying thrilling pace with genuine long-distance comfort and a cabin that’s actually liveable. If you crave weekend escape capability without surrendering driver engagement, this is the car to consider — though it does attract a fair share of admiring glances.
